## Deployment

The Givenwell receipt mailer ships as a single container and must be released in lockstep with the Almsbridge donations API. Verify the template bundle version matches before promoting to production, and confirm the queue drain completed from the prior release. The deployment requires the configuration values listed directly below.

deployment values, yadug-bawif:
[framir]
team = pelox
access_code = ac_a38ab2
owner = tamion.julael
host = framir.tolvaqlabs.test
port = 11211
peer = tammir.zemvargrid.local
salt = 2215ef03
pin = 1541

To the heads of department,

A brief update on the Meridex reseller programme ahead of Thursday's session. Partner recruitment closed with fourteen signed agreements, slightly above target. Training completion sits at 80%; the remainder conclude next week. Early order volumes are modest but consistent with ramp assumptions. Finance will circulate revised channel margin figures separately. Please review before the executive meeting. The confidential planning context appears below.

Regards,
T. Avensel

confidential, kagep-kahof: Druokax Systems plans to lower the Ulaath list price by 53 percent in March.

## RateMatch Sentry — Environments

Hey support folks! RateMatch Sentry is our rate-parity checker — it scans partner hotel listings and flags mismatched prices. There's a sandbox env (fake hotels, safe to poke) and prod (don't poke). Most escalations come from sandbox confusion, so check which one the customer hit first. For reference, the sandbox runs with these configuration values.

deployment values, yadup-kadug:
[sorys]
port = 5672
team = noveth
host = sorys.orvexcorp.example
region = south-4
access_code = ac_deddc1
timeout_ms = 1500

## Runbook: webhook retry semantics (Corvane dispatcher)

Failed deliveries retry with exponential backoff: 30s, 2m, 10m, then hourly up to 24h. A 410 response cancels all retries; 429 honors Retry-After. Reviewers should confirm handlers are idempotent, since the dispatcher does not deduplicate across retry attempts — use the delivery sequence header for ordering. Retry workers sign each attempt before dispatch, and the signing credential belongs on the line directly after this one.

vault entry, yahif-yajep: COURIER_KEY29=b802bdf8034096b65a51c6ba5abe2